Patient mobility for cardiac problems: a risk-adjusted analysis in Italy
Gabriele Messina1, Silvia Forni, Francesca Collini
1Department of Public Health, Health Services Research Laboratory, University of Siena, Via Aldo Moro, 2 Siena, 53100, Italy. gabriele.messina@unisi.it

Summary
Patient mobility in cardiac surgery varies by disease severity. One health area struggled to meet demand for moderate severity patients, highlighting the need for severity-stratified analysis in healthcare planning.
Area of Science:
- Health Services Research
- Healthcare Management
- Public Health
Background:
- The Italian National Health System's quasi-market structure allows patient choice, making patient mobility an indicator of hospital quality and regional financial flows.
- Previous research on patient mobility has not sufficiently considered the influence of patient condition severity.
- Cardiac surgery units in Tuscany, Italy, were examined to understand patient mobility dynamics.
Purpose of the Study:
- To describe patient mobility in cardiac surgery units within three Tuscan health areas (HAs).
- To analyze patient mobility stratified by disease severity using All Patient Refined Diagnosis Related Group (APR-DRG) levels.
- To assess the capacity of HAs to meet local healthcare demand and attract patients.
Main Methods:
- A retrospective observational study using hospital discharge records from the Tuscan Regional Health Agency (2001-2007).
- Stratification of 25,017 planned cardiac surgery hospitalizations into four APR-DRG severity levels.
- Application of Gandy's nomogram for demand assessment and Cuzick's test for trend analysis.
Main Results:
- Overall, HAs met their local healthcare demand.
- Severity stratification revealed that one HA (HA3) had a reduced capacity to manage moderate severity cases and attract patients.
- HA3 also showed a decrease in local resident admissions, indicating a potential decline in perceived quality or capacity for complex cases.
Conclusions:
- Disease severity stratification is crucial for uncovering significant differences in healthcare demand management between HAs.
- HA1 and HA2 demonstrated consistent ability to manage local demand across severity levels, unlike HA3.
- Severity-stratified data offers valuable insights for healthcare planners and researchers to improve comparisons and interventions in patient mobility.
